LONDON, UK - SEP 27: London Street view with iconic telephone box on September 27, 2013 in London, UK. London is the world's most visited city and the
LONDON, UK - SEP 27: London Street view with iconic telephone box on September 27, 2013 in London, UK. London is the world's most visited city and the capital of UK.
Size: 5094px × 3400px
Photo credit: © Songquan Deng / Alamy / Afripics
License: Royalty Free
Model Released: No
Keywords: -, 27:, architecture, attraction, beautiful, booth, box, britain, british, building, city, cityscape, england, english, europe, exterior, famous, historic, historical, history, icon, iconic, kingdoms, landmark, london, outdoors, sep, street, telephone, travel, uk, united, urban, view